Thermostat rep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ues related to household or commercial temperature control systems. Technicians inspect thermostats to identify malfunctions such as inaccurate temperature readings, unresponsive controls, or wiring problems. Repair work may include replacing faulty components, recalibrating the thermostat, or updating outdated units to ensure proper operation. The goal is to restore accurate temperature regulation, which contributes to comfort and energy efficiency within the property.
These services help resolve common problems like thermostats that fail to turn heating or cooling systems on or off, inconsistent temperature control, or electronic display errors. Malfunctioning thermostats can lead to increased energy bills, uneven heating or cooling, and system wear due to improper cycling. Professional repair ensures that the thermostat functions correctly, preventing unnecessary strain on HVAC equipment and maintaining consistent indoor climate control.

The overview below groups typical Thermostat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Woodland Hills,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Service Call Fees - Typically, service call fees for thermostat repair range from $75 to $150. This fee covers the technician’s visit and initial assessment, regardless of repair costs.
Repair Costs - The cost to repair a thermostat usually falls between $100 and $250, depending on the issue and parts needed. Simple sensor replacements tend to be on the lower end, while control board repairs are higher.
Replacement Expenses - Replacing a thermostat can cost between $150 and $300 for standard models, with smart thermostats often priced from $200 to $350. Installation fees may be included or charged separately.
Additional Charges - Additional costs may apply for complex repairs or parts, which can add $50 to $200 to the overall bill. These vary based on the specific thermostat and repair requ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my thermostat needs repair? Signs such as inconsistent heating or cooling, unresponsive controls, or frequent system cycling may indicate a thermostat issue, and a local professional can assess the problem.
What types of thermostats can be repaired? Commonly repaired thermostats include digital, programmable, and smart models, depending on the specific device and its condition.
How long does thermostat repair typically take? Repair times can vary based on the issue, but most repairs are completed within a few hours by experienced service providers.
Is thermostat repair necessary if my system is still functioning? Not necessarily; even if the system operates, a malfunctioning thermostat can cause inefficiency or uneven temperatures, making repair advisable.
